**Vendor note: Inkmill markdown pipeline**

Rendering for Parchway docs is outsourced to Inkmill under an annual contract, renewing each March. They handle sanitization and PDF export; we own the upload queue. SLA: 4-hour response on rendering failures. Escalate only after two failed retries. Their support desk is reachable at the address below.

billing contact of hahaf-baguf = zorael.tammir.jorius@sivrelhq.internal

Capacity note: Dripstone's ledger converter accumulates sub-cent drift under load. At ~40k conversions/min the rounding residue buffer fills faster than the reconciliation sweep drains it. Support should not raise the sweep interval past the documented ceiling; escalate to the Kestrel team instead. Current tuning constants for the residue buffer and sweep are as follows.

tuning table, fadup-kawif:
QUOTAS = {
    "ulaath": 5,
    "zorix": 2,
}

**Finance Review — Logistics Provider Change**

Switching from Tarnwell Haulage to Orlix Distribution yields projected annual savings of 11% against current spend. One-off transition costs land in Q2; breakeven expected within fourteen months. Fuel surcharge exposure drops under the new fixed-rate terms. Heads of department should hold discretionary freight spend until cutover completes. Remaining risk sits with the Ferndale depot lease. The confidential planning note appears below.

internal memo for kawip-hadug: Headcount on the Wenwyn team goes from 7 to 140 by the end of January. Gross margin on Wenwyn came in at 20 percent against a plan of 15 percent.

## Partner SFTP Drop — Quick Notes

So, Marbleline Logistics pushes a nightly file into our SFTP drop around 02:00. If the ingest job complains about a missing file, don't panic — their upload sometimes slips an hour. Wait until 03:30 before escalating. If the file arrives but fails checksum, move it to the quarantine folder and rerun the fetcher manually. Never delete anything in the drop; retention scripts handle cleanup. Full credentials rotation steps and the partner contact process are documented here:

wiki page, tahaf-tajog: https://jira.ordindyn.corp/pipeline